Maryland Restaurant Management Jobs: A Thriving Industry Maryland is known for its amazing seafood, and the state's restaurant industry is booming. The restaurant industry is a significant contributor to Maryland's economy, and it offers a wide range of job opportunities for individuals interested in pursuing a career in restaurant management. Maryland is home to many prestigious restaurants, from upscale fine dining establishments to casual eateries, and the state's restaurant industry is always on the lookout for talented individuals with a passion for food and hospitality. Restaurant Management Jobs in Maryland Restaurant management jobs in Maryland encompass a wide range of roles, from chefs and cooks to servers and front-of-house staff. However, it is the role of the restaurant manager that is the most important in the successful running of any restaurant. Restaurant managers are responsible for overseeing all aspects of restaurant operations, from managing employees to maintaining inventory and profitability. Restaurant managers are also in charge of ensuring that customers receive excellent service, and that the restaurant is always clean and welcoming. There are many opportunities for restaurant management jobs in Maryland, with positions in both high-end and casual dining establishments. In high-end restaurants, the role of the restaurant manager is often more formal and structured, with a focus on providing the highest level of service to customers. In casual dining establishments, the focus is more on efficiency and speed of service, with managers often working closely with the kitchen to ensure that food is prepared quickly and accurately. Requirements for Restaurant Management Jobs Restaurant management jobs in Maryland require a wide range of skills and qualifications, including experience in the food and beverage industry, excellent communication and leadership skills, and a passion for providing great customer service. Most restaurant management jobs also require a degree in hospitality management or a related field, although experience in restaurant management may be accepted in lieu of a degree. In addition to education and experience, restaurant managers must possess a wide range of skills, including: 1. Leadership skills: Restaurant managers must be able to lead and motivate a team of employees, ensuring that everyone is working together and performing at their best. 2. Communication skills: Restaurant managers must be able to communicate effectively with employees, customers, and vendors, as well as being able to write reports, create schedules, and manage budgets. 3. Financial skills: Restaurant managers must be able to manage budgets, order supplies, and ensure that the restaurant is profitable. 4. Problem-solving skills: Restaurant managers must be able to quickly and effectively solve problems that arise, such as customer complaints or staffing issues. 5. Time management skills: Restaurant managers must be able to manage their time effectively, ensuring that all tasks are completed on time and that the restaurant is running smoothly. Salary and Benefits for Restaurant Managers Restaurant management jobs in Maryland offer competitive salaries and benefits. According to Indeed.com, the average salary for a restaurant manager in Maryland is $51,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$34,000 to $78,000 per year depending on the size and type of restaurant. In addition to salary, restaurant managers may also receive benefits such as health insurance, paid vacation time, and retirement plans. Career Opportunities for Restaurant Managers Restaurant management jobs in Maryland offer a wide range of career opportunities, from entry-level positions to executive roles. With experience and a proven track record of success, restaurant managers can advance to higher-level positions such as regional manager, director of operations, or even CEO. In addition to traditional restaurant management jobs, there are also opportunities for entrepreneurs to start their own restaurant businesses in Maryland. Starting a restaurant business requires a significant investment of time and money, but for those with a passion for food and hospitality, it can be a rewarding and lucrative career path. Conclusion Maryland's restaurant industry offers a wide range of job opportunities for individuals interested in pursuing a career in restaurant management. With a strong economy and a growing demand for high-quality dining experiences, restaurant management jobs in Maryland are in high demand. Restaurant managers must possess a wide range of skills, including leadership, communication, financial management, problem-solving, and time management skills. With competitive salaries and benefits, as well as opportunities for career advancement, restaurant management jobs in Maryland are an excellent choice for individuals looking for a rewarding and exciting career in the food and beverage industry.

The future is always uncertain, but one thing is certain: the Canadian job market is changing. With the rise of technology and automation, many jobs that exist today will become obsolete in the future. However, this does not mean that there will be a shortage of jobs in Canada. On the contrary, there are many jobs that will be in high demand in the future. In this article, we will explore some of the jobs that will be needed in the future Canada. 1. Healthcare Professionals The healthcare industry is one of the fastest-growing industries in Canada. As the population ages, there will be an increased demand for healthcare professionals. According to a report by the Conference Board of Canada, the healthcare industry is expected to create 1.3 million jobs by 2025. Some of the jobs that will be in high demand include nurses, doctors, pharmacists, and physiotherapists. 2. Data Analysts With the rise of big data, there will be a need for professionals who can analyze and interpret this data. Data analysts will be in high demand in industries such as finance, healthcare, and marketing. According to a report by the Canadian Chamber of Commerce, the demand for data analysts in Canada is expected to grow by 50% by 2021. 3. Cybersecurity Specialists As technology continues to advance, the threat of cyber attacks is increasing. Cybersecurity specialists will be needed to protect companies and organizations from these attacks. According to a report by Cybersecurity Ventures, the global demand for cybersecurity professionals is expected to reach 3.5 million by 2021. 4. Renewable Energy Professionals As the world moves towards renewable energy, there will be a need for professionals who can design, install, and maintain these systems. Jobs in the renewable energy industry include solar panel installers, wind turbine technicians, and energy auditors. According to a report by the International Renewable Energy Agency, the renewable energy industry is expected to create 42 million jobs globally by 2050. 5. Artificial Intelligence Specialists Artificial intelligence (AI) is becoming increasingly important in many industries, including healthcare, finance, and manufacturing. AI specialists will be needed to develop and implement AI solutions. According to a report by the Canadian Institute for Advanced Research, the demand for AI specialists in Canada is expected to grow by 30% by 2021. 6. Environmental Scientists As the world becomes more aware of the impact of climate change, there will be a need for professionals who can develop and implement solutions to mitigate the effects of climate change. Environmental scientists will be needed to conduct research, develop policies, and implement programs to protect the environment. According to a report by Environment and Climate Change Canada, the environmental industry is expected to create 319,000 jobs by 2025. 7. Digital Marketers As companies continue to move towards digital marketing, there will be a need for professionals who can develop and implement digital marketing strategies. Digital marketers will be needed to create content, manage social media accounts, and analyze data. According to a report by Burning Glass Technologies, the demand for digital marketing professionals in Canada is expected to grow by 38% by 2021. 8. Biotechnology Professionals The biotechnology industry is growing rapidly, and there will be a need for professionals who can develop and implement new technologies and treatments. Biotechnology professionals will be needed to conduct research, develop new drugs, and design new medical devices. According to a report by Biotechnology Innovation Organization, the biotechnology industry is expected to create 220,000 jobs by 2023. 9. Skilled Tradespeople Skilled tradespeople will always be in demand in Canada. There will be a need for professionals who can build and maintain infrastructure, such as roads, bridges, and buildings. Skilled tradespeople include carpenters, plumbers, electricians, and welders. According to a report by BuildForce Canada, the construction industry is expected to create 307,000 jobs by 2028. 10. Educators As the demand for skilled professionals increases, there will be a need for educators who can train the next generation of workers. Educators will be needed to teach the skills and knowledge required for the jobs of the future. According to a report by the Canadian Council on Learning, the demand for educators in Canada is expected to grow by 10% by 2031. In conclusion, while the job market is constantly changing, there are many jobs that will be in high demand in the future Canada. It is important for students and job seekers to be aware of these trends and to consider pursuing careers in these fields. By doing so, they will be setting themselves up for success in the future job market.
